U266 cells according to the TRIzol manufacturer’s protocol (InvitrogenTM, USA). A total of
2000 ng of RNA was reverse transcribed using specific miRNA stem-loop primers from Qiagen
for miR-19a to generate cDNA using a Hyperscript Reverse Transcriptase First-strand
Synthesis kit (GeneAll Biotechnology Co., Ltd., Korea). Snord47 was used as the internal
control for normalization of miRNA expression. Quantitative real-time polymerase chain
reaction (qRT-PCR) was performed with a SYBR® Premix Ex Taq™ miRNA RT-qPCR Detection Kit
(Takara, USA, cat. no. RR820Q) using a Qiagen Rotor-Gene Q 5PLEX HRM Real-Time PCR. Table
1 shows the primer sequences used in this experiment. The PCR program cycling parameters
were: 95˚C for 15 seconds, 58˚C for 30 seconds, and 72˚C for 30 seconds for 45 cycles.
Data analysis was done by 2-ΔΔCT to calculate the fold change for relative
miR-19a expression compared to the untreated control.
